The movie 'No Mercy' delves into the dark and disturbing world of bullying, exploring the far-reaching consequences of such actions and the resilience of a sister's love and determination. When a younger sister named Emma goes missing, her older sister, Sarah, embarks on a desperate search for her. Unbeknownst to Sarah, Emma had been subject to years of physical and emotional torture at the hands of her tormentors, who not only belittled her but also subjected her to heinous acts of violence and sexual abuse. As Sarah delves deeper into the mystery surrounding Emma's disappearance, she discovers the dark underbelly of the school system and the extent to which teachers and staff turned a blind eye to the horrors that Emma suffered. The film portrays a twisted environment where perpetrators of bullying were often protected, while the victims were left to fend for themselves. Determined to bring the truth to light and find her sister, Sarah becomes obsessed with uncovering the identity of the bullies responsible for Emma's suffering. Her investigation exposes a web of deceit and corruption that reaches the highest echelons of the school's administration. Undeterred by the danger that lies ahead, Sarah confronts the perpetrators, each one more reprehensible than the last. The film's portrayal of the school bullies is stark and unflinching, revealing individuals who were once considered normal, ordinary children, but who had been warped by the societal pressures around them. These individuals had descended into a world of toxic masculinity, where their actions were justified by a twisted sense of entitlement and their own sadistic desires. One of the bullies, in particular, stands out – a charismatic and well-respected student who had used his charm and good looks to manipulate his way to the top of the social hierarchy. This individual had orchestrated Emma's humiliation and torture, using her as a toy to feed his twisted desires. The film's portrayal of this character serves as a stark reminder that the perpetrators of bullying are not always the obvious choices, but often individuals who present themselves as normal, even likable. As Sarah's search for Emma intensifies, she becomes increasingly determined to bring the perpetrators to justice. Along the way, she faces numerous obstacles, including the reluctance of school authorities to confront the issue and the trauma that she experiences as she delves deeper into her sister's suffering. The film's climax is both shocking and heartbreaking, as Sarah finally uncovers the truth about Emma's disappearance. In a tense and emotional confrontation, Sarah forces the bullies to reveal the truth about what happened to her sister. The film ultimately serves as a powerful indictment of the school system's failures and a testament to the resilience of a sister's love. In the aftermath of the truth emerging, the film takes a poignant turn, as Sarah comes to terms with the trauma that Emma suffered and the fact that she was unable to protect her sister. The movie concludes on a hopeful note, with Sarah finding solace in the knowledge that justice has been served and that her sister's story will not be forgotten.
